rainbow falls


Today I hiked up from downtown Hilo to the Rainbow Falls, just a few miles out of town. From there I went on to Pe'epe'e Falls. There wasn't as much water as normal, but they were still pretty. The weather was really good (it usually rains a lot around here). After that I went back into town and walked around there for a while. There's not much to see here, but I like the laidback small town feeling. It feels like Jamaica around here.
